发布时间:2025-04-05来源:互联网作者:新瑶
在Linux操作系统中,了解系统上已安装的软件包对于系统管理、故障排除以及软件版本控制非常重要。本文将深入探讨在Linux系统中查看已安装软件的各种命令与方法,包括常见的Linux发行版,如Debian、Ubuntu、RHEL、CentOS等。
对于基于Debian的发行版(如Ubuntu),可以通过以下命令查看已安装的软件包:
1. dpkg命令
dpkg是Debian系统中用于管理软件包的工具。要列出所有已安装的软件包,可以使用以下命令:
dpkg -l
此命令会列出所有已安装的软件包及其版本信息。同时可以通过grep命令来筛选特定软件,例如:
dpkg -l | grep <软件包名称>
2. apt命令
Apt是Debian和Ubuntu中用于软件包管理的另一种工具,通过它也可以查看已安装的软件包。使用以下命令:
apt list --installed
这条命令同样会列出系统上所有已安装的软件包。
对于基于RHEL的发行版(如CentOS),可以使用以下命令进行查看:
1. rpm命令
RPM是RHEL及其衍生版本中用来管理软件包的工具,安装的软件包都会以.rpm为后缀。要查看已安装的软件包,可以使用以下命令:
rpm -qa
这将列出所有已安装的包,同样,你可以使用grep命令来查找特定的包:
rpm -qa | grep <软件包名称>
2. yum命令
对于使用YUM包管理器的系统,可以使用以下命令来列出所有已安装的软件包:
yum list installed
YUM会列出所有的已安装软件包以及对应的版本信息。
除了各个发行版的特定命令外,还有一些通用的方法来查看已安装软件包:
1. 使用whereis命令
whereis命令可以用来查找可执行文件、源代码和手册页。虽然它不是专门用来列出已安装软件的命令,但可以用来查看某个软件的具体位置。例如:
whereis <软件包名称>
2. 使用which命令
which命令用于查找可执行文件的位置,可以帮助确认某个软件包是否已安装。例如:
which <软件包名称>
对于不熟悉命令行的用户,Linux系统中也提供了一些图形化工具来管理软件包。例如,Ubuntu中的“软件中心”允许用户查看、安装和删除软件,而在CentOS中,用户可以通过“GNOME软件”或“KDE Discover”进行软件管理。
了解如何查看已安装的软件包是Linux系统管理的重要一环。无论是通过命令行工具如dpkg、apt、rpm和yum,还是使用图形化的安装管理工具,每种方法都有其优势和适用场景。熟练掌握这些技能,不仅能够提高系统管理的效率,还能为日常的软件维护提供便利。
希望本文能帮助你更好地理解Linux系统中的软件管理,提升你的Linux使用体验。
2024-03-14
魔兽三国塔防地图 魔兽三国塔防地图玩法攻略
巅峰极速gtr18 巅峰极速GTR18震撼发布
荣耀崛起农场 荣耀崛起庄园
古墓笔记和怀线 古墓笔记怀线探秘
猫和老鼠手游奥尼玛国服系列 猫和老鼠手游奥尼玛国服资讯
《脑洞大侦探》第2关中的隐藏物体在哪里
《COK列王的纷争》手游金矿采集指南
《英雄联盟手游》虎年限定皮肤介绍
剑与契约下架了么